About the role

The Alaska VA Healthcare System is seeking Medical Support Assistant (MSA) positions in the Office of Community Care in Anchorage, AK. Applications are valid for up to 90 days to fill any additional vacancies.

Responsibilities

  • Interact with both internal and external customers
  • Establish and maintain medical outpatient and inpatient charts and administrative records
  • Verify third-party insurance and update information in the Insurance Capture Buffer (ICB) system
  • Obtain medical information from patients
  • Coordinate information and actions related to patient care and services
  • Schedule appointments in accordance with VHA national scheduling guidelines
  • Refer all questions requiring immediate medical attention to appropriate health care team members
  • Schedule, cancel, and reschedule patient appointments and/or consults
  • Enter no-show information, monitor the electronic wait list, prepare for clinic visits, and ensure encounter forms are completed
  • Verify and update demographics and insurance information
  • Process all emergency and non-emergency transfers to other VA facilities or private hospitals
  • Perform basic eligibility, co-pays, and preauthorization requirements for specific coverage
